How this was measured: This report summarises 55 public Reddit threads collected across 17 subreddits through the Reddit API. Thread counts, subreddit shares, the weekly trend, and the date range are computed from those threads alone. Replies have not been collected for this brand yet, so the sentiment split is derived from thread titles and the question each thread asks, which leaves most threads unlabelled; the labels come from a fixed word list, not from human review. This is a sample of public discussion, not a complete or representative measure of it, and not a customer satisfaction score.

55 public Reddit threads about Latenode were collected across 17 subreddits, led by r/Latenode. The dominant question type is cost questions (6 of 55), and the highest-scoring thread in the sample is "I tested 6 customizable automation platforms for 90 days. Here’s my honest ranking.". This report summarises those threads only; it is not a measure of Latenode's overall standing.

Stance mix: 2% positive · 95% neutral · 4% negative across 55 collected threads, labelled from thread titles alone because replies have not been collected for this brand yet rather than by hand.
